What is Teeth Whitening?

Teeth whitening is the process of lightening the existing colour of teeth. A range of teeth whitening treatment options are available, from the use of take-home whitening treatment trays, which you can carry out yourself at the comfort of your house, to more professional procedures like Philips Zoom!® teeth whitening, which must be completed in-chair by a dental professional.

These teeth whitening procedures involve the application of a whitening agent, like hydrogen peroxide gel, to the teeth to remove stains from the enamel, leaving the structure of the teeth.

Philips Zoom!® Teeth Whitening (In Chair)

Philips Zoom!® Teeth Whitening is a professional tooth whitening treatment that is carried out in a chair by a dental professional. The procedure is preceded by regular teeth clean by your dentist, followed by a brief preparation of the mouth. This is to protect the gums and lips while leaving the teeth exposed. The teeth are then painted with the Philips Zoom!® whitening gel, which is activated by ultraviolet light or laser to expedite the process.

Teeth Whitening (Home Kits)

Interested in whitening your teeth but unable to commit to an in-chair appointment? Improve your smile from home with our take-home tooth whitening kit.

You place a custom-made bleaching tray filled with active carbamide peroxide gel over your teeth for 1-2 hours daily for 10 days and you repeat the process for seven to ten days to achieve the best results.

What Causes Teeth to Stain or Discolour?

Tooth discolouration is part of the natural ageing process. Our teeth gradually become yellower as we grow older. In addition, certain coloured foods and drinks are more likely to cause teeth to stain when we consume them.

Clinical studies have shown that red wine, sugary drinks, tea and coffee are the most common culprits for tooth discolouration, but smoking also stains teeth, especially if the habit has been going on for a while. Old fillings, nerve degeneration, excessive amounts of fluoride and certain antibiotics are also are causative factors that result in teeth discolouring.

How Long Does Teeth Whitening Last?

The effects of teeth whitening can last up to three years provided you stay away from smoking or consuming coloured food or drinks that can stain teeth. In general, it is advisable to repeat the procedure as often as necessary, depending on your lifestyle.
